Landscape Designer Career

Landscape design is one of those careers that blends creativity with real earning potential - and you don’t need a degree to get started. In this episode, we talk with landscape designer and gardener Dean Riddle about what it actually takes to build a career in landscaping, what garden designers really do, and how much you can make.

We also talk about the realities of gardening in the Northeast- especially in places like New York and New Jersey - including short growing seasons, winter downtime, deer pressure, and how climate change is already changing what grows and when.

If you’re looking into landscaping careers, garden design jobs, or how to start a landscaping business without a degree, this episode gives you a clear, real-world look at what goes into the work and the potential earnings.

About the host: Mirav Ozeri has always been drawn to storytelling and journalism, especially the stories of everyday people.

In the 90’s She founded her own video production company, producing, directing, and editing documentaries and videos for political organizations which led to a 17-year career at CBS News, where she served as a producer/editor, helped launch CBS MarketWatch, and later worked as a senior editor and segment producer until the program was acquired by Dow Jones.

During her years at CBS, Mirav developed and produced a television pilot built around a simple idea: giving people an honest look at what different careers are really like. Although the pilot was never picked up, the concept stayed with her. Years later, she brought it back as How Much Can I Make?, a podcast that explores real jobs, real stories, and the many paths people take to build a career.
